Next Monday, March 21 at 7pm, Veterans Campaign will host Senator Chuck Hagel at its inaugural Distinguished Speaker Series event at The George Washington University. Senator Hagel will speak about his journey from the U.S. Army to the U.S. Senate, and how his military service influenced his decision to continue serving in elected office. There will be ample time for questions as well as a light reception. The event is open to the public, and there is no cost to attend. Please RVSP by filling out the required information below.

The event, sponsored by The George Washington University, will be held in the lower level of the Media and Public Affairs Building, 805 21st Street, NW (between H & I), and will go from 7-9 pm. The event will provide interested veterans with the chance to meet and interact with distinguished individuals who have successfully transitioned from the military to public life, and will also present a terrific opportunity for networking and camaraderie. Veterans Campaign plans to host six to ten similar events over the next year.
